在/usr/local/nginx/html下创建index.php文件,输入如下内容 1 2 3 <?php echophpinfo(); ?> 五、启动服务 启动php-fpm和nginx /usr/local/php/sbin/php-fpm #手动打补丁的启动方式/usr/local/php/sbin/php-fpm start sudo/usr/local/nginx/nginx php-fpm关闭重启见文章结尾 六、浏览器访问 访问http://...
原因:nginx作为代理,是提交请求给php-fpm的,并没有涉及到IO(即读写),只是启动程序,时间极短无阻塞问题。就算你设置了大于内核数,也只是在做队列等待,没有意义。 二、php-fpm 配置文件:php-fpm.conf 关键参数: //设置类型static(静态)或者dynamic(动态),静态下是固定的进程数,动态的情况下,会关闭或开启新的...
location ~ \.php {}块把 HTTP 请求转发给 PHP-FPM 进程池进行处理,在这个块中我们把 PHP 请求转发到端口9000让 PHP-FPM 处理请求。 在Ubuntu 中我们必须执行以下命令,在/etc/nginx/sites-enable目录下创建虚拟主机配置文件的符号链接: sudo ln -s /etc/nginx/sites-available/example.conf /etc/nginx/sites...
1、首先安装php70与php-fpm 使用yum , 注意拓展的开启问题, 开启必要拓展。 https://www.cnblogs.com/pandawan/p/11100311.html 注意: 安装php7后, 相应的安装拓展也是与70关联的版本。 2、开启php-fpm service php-fpm start 3、配置nginx支持php-fpm nginx安装完成后,修改nginx配置文件为,nginx.conf 其中...
1. 安装 Nginx yum install nginx 1. 开启Nginx 并设置开机启动 systemctl start nginx 1. systemctl enable nginx 1. 完成后,输入 localhost 会显示如下页面,表示安装成功,该页面会由两个信息,一个是配置文件的路径,一个是 www 目录的路径 2. 安装最新版本的 PHP、PHP-FPM ...
1.进入 /usr/local/nginx/conf/nginx.confvim,并将下图中的配置取消注释图1修改fastcgi_param 如下图$document_roo...
接下来是 nginx 配置: location ~ \.php($|/) { # 下面这一行设置 $fastcgi_script_name 和 $fastcgi_path_info 的值,具体请看 nginx 文档 fastcgi_split_path_info ^(.+\.php)(/.+)$; # 下面这行也可以为 fastcgi_pass unix:/var/run/php-fpm.sock 看你的 fpm 设置了 ...
(五)CentOS 8.0 LEMP (with Nginx, MySQL , and PHP-FPM)安装 (六)增加Nginx维护页面,临时维护使用 (七)完成 LEMP基础配置后,升级性能和安全性,其它配置 (八)Node环境配置(请完成此文档上面所以步骤后再继续) 开始之前,我们先熟悉一些整个过程常用的一些命令: ...
Apache和Nginx是两种常见的Web服务器,它们都支持PHP。 安装Web服务器时,确保安装了PHP模块。 对于Nginx,可以使用fastcgi_pass来配置PHP-FPM。 3. 配置PHP-FPM 重点: 正确配置PHP-FPM以优化性能。 设置合理的最大工作进程和监听端口。 细节: PHP-FPM(FastCGI Process Manager)是管理PHP进程的一种方式,可以提高性能...
重启PHP动服务器(例如Apache、PHP-FPM) 由于oneapm-daemon进程在安装过程中会自动启动,因此在重启服务器之前先将oneapm-daemon进程停止 命令:oneapm-daemon -s stop 这里使用的服务器是Nginx+PHP-FPM,所以只需要重启PHP-FPM即可 在重启PHP-FPM或者是httpd时,oneapm-daemon进程自动启动 ...